General Liability Insurance for Rough Carpenters
Rough carpenters work on the structural framework of buildings, which often involves high-risk environments where property damage or injuries can occur. General Liability Insurance covers third-party claims, such as damage to a client’s property or injuries sustained by visitors on the job site.
This insurance also takes care of legal defence fees, settlements, and related costs, ensuring your carpentry business is not overwhelmed by unexpected claims. It gives your clients the confidence that you are operating as a licensed and insured rough carpenter.

Business Owner’s Policy (BOP) for Rough Carpenters
A Business Owner’s Policy (BOP) provides well-rounded protection by combining general liability and property insurance. For rough carpenters, this means safeguarding essential tools, equipment, and office space from risks like fire, theft, or vandalism.
The business interruption coverage included in a BOP also helps replace income if operations are paused due to a covered incident. This ensures financial stability while you recover and get back to projects without unnecessary delays.

Workers’ Compensation Insurance for Rough Carpenters
Rough carpentry involves heavy lifting, cutting, working at heights, and handling power tools—activities that can easily lead to workplace injuries. Workers’ Compensation Insurance covers medical bills, rehabilitation, and lost wages if an employee gets hurt while working.
Even independent carpenters benefit from workers’ comp, as it ensures financial support in case an accident prevents them from working. For employers, workers’ comp is legally required in California to protect their team.

1. Is rough carpenter insurance mandatory in California?
If you have employees, California requires workers’ comp insurance by law. Even if you’re a solo contractor, clients or general contractors often require you to show proof of general liability insurance before you can step on-site. 2. What’s the difference between general liability and professional liability for rough carpenters?
General liability insurance covers bodily injury or property damage caused during construction. Professional liability, on the other hand, covers design errors or project mismanagement. If you’re offering any kind of design advice, having both types of coverage is smart. Learn more here.
